The three most common minerals on Earth's crust are quartz, feldspar, and mica. These minerals are abundant in rocks and have widespread distribution around the world.
Quartz and feldspar are the two minerals that make up most of the sand in the world. Quartz is a common mineral found in many rocks, and feldspar is a group of minerals that are also abundant in the Earth's crust.
